Massey Ferguson 1095 Production











Manufacturer:
Manufacturer: Massey Ferguson
Type: Row-Crop tractor
Factory: Granadero Baigorria, Santa Fe, Argentina


Massey Ferguson 1095 Electrical



















Ground: negative
Charging system: alternator
Charging amps: 32
Batteries: 2
Battery volts: 12
Battery AH: 86

Massey Ferguson 1095 Mechanical


















Chassis: 4×2 2WD
Steering: power
Brakes: disc
Cab: Open operator station.
Transmission: 8-speed gear

Power Take-off (PTO)







Rear RPM: 540 (1.375)
Engine RPM: 540@1700

Massey Ferguson 1095 Engine detail


































Engine Detail
Perkins A.6-354
diesel
6-cylinder
liquid-cooled
Displacement: 354 ci
5.8 L
Bore/Stroke: 3.875×5.00 inches
98 x 127 mm
Power: 95 hp
70.8 kW
Compression: 16:1
Rated RPM: 2200
Firing order: 1-5-3-6-2-4
Starter: electric
Starter volts: 12

Massey Ferguson 1095 Dimensions



















Wheelbase: 96.5 inches
245 cm
Length: 143.7 inches
364 cm
Width: 82.3 inches
209 cm
Height (steering wheel): 70.9 inches
180 cm
Weight: 11964 lbs
5426 kg
Ground clearance: 21.7 inches
55 cm
